How to use FTP to retrieve log files
You can use FTP to retrieve a tab-delineated Event Log (event.txt) or Data
Log (data.txt) file that you can import into a spreadsheet application.
• The file reports all of the events (event.txt) or data (data.txt) recorded
since the log was last deleted.
• The file includes information that the Event Log or Data Log does not
display.
– The version of the file format (first field)

To use FTP to retrieve the event.txt or data.txt file:
1. At a command prompt, type ftp and the Management Card’s IP
address, and press
E
NTER
. If the
Port
setting for
FTP Server
in the
Network
menu has changed from its default value (21), you must use
the non-default value in the FTP command. For some FTP clients, you
must use a colon to add the port number to the end of the IP address.
For Windows FTP clients, use the following command (including
spaces):
ftp>open ip_address port_number
The Management Card uses a 4-digit year for log entries.
You may need to select a four-digit date format in your
spreadsheet application to display all four digits of the year.
